Output c77978b6fbf3bdb365c287d7421f3a233e69bf93d35aeaf9f3079d50dfd36314:1

value
17277
script pubkey
OP_0 OP_PUSHBYTES_20 d2063e0786977fe0aea2c7d2b3a67a3198072e1b
address
bc1q6grrupuxjal7pt4zclft8fn6xxvqwtsma4kuqd
transaction
c77978b6fbf3bdb365c287d7421f3a233e69bf93d35aeaf9f3079d50dfd36314
confirmations
137549
spent
true